BIT101-API
首页BIT101
BIT101企划
  • BIT101
  • BIT101-GO
  • BIT101-Android
首页BIT101
BIT101企划
  • BIT101
  • BIT101-GO
  • BIT101-Android
BIT101
  1. 话廊模块
  • BIT101 API总览
  • 用户模块
    • 用户模块介绍
    • 学校统一身份验证初始化
      POST
    • 学校统一身份认证验证
      POST
    • 发送邮件验证码
      POST
    • 注册/重置密码/code登录
      POST
    • 登录
      POST
    • 获取用户信息
      GET
    • 获取用户信息(老)
      GET
    • 修改用户信息
      PUT
    • 关注
      POST
    • 关注列表
      GET
    • 粉丝列表
      GET
    • 检查登录状态
      GET
  • 上传模块
    • 通过文件上传图片
      POST
    • 通过链接上传图片
      POST
  • 交互反馈模块
    • 点赞
      POST
    • 评论列表
      GET
    • 评论
      POST
    • 评论删除
      DELETE
    • 停留时间
      POST
  • 文章模块
    • 获取文章列表
    • 获取文章
    • 新建文章
    • 更新文章
    • 删除文章
  • 教务模块
    • 成绩查询
    • 获取可信成绩单
    • 获取课程表
  • 课程模块
    • 获取课程列表
    • 获取课程详细信息
    • 获取课程历史信息
    • 获取课程资料上传链接
    • 上报课程资料上传记录
  • 变量模块
    • 获取变量
    • 设置变量
  • 消息模块
    • 消息模块说明
    • 获取未读消息总数
    • 获取分类未读消息数量
    • 获取消息列表
    • 发送系统消息
  • 话廊模块
    • 获取帖子列表
      GET
    • 获取帖子
      GET
    • 发布帖子
      POST
    • 更新帖子
      PUT
    • 删除帖子
      DELETE
    • 获取声明列表
      GET
  • 治理模块
    • 举报
    • 获取举报列表
    • 修改举报状态
    • 获取举报类型列表
    • 关小黑屋
    • 获取小黑屋列表
  • 学校教务接口
    • 课程表
      • 课程表模块流程
      • 我的课表主页
      • 获取访问权限
      • 更改语言为中文
      • 获取当前学期
      • 获取所有学期
      • 获取学期课表
      • 获取星期日期
    • 统一身份验证
      • 登录流程
      • 登录
      • 查询是否需要验证码
      • 获取验证码
      • 登录 Copy
    • 成绩
      • 查询所有课程成绩
      • 单个课程成绩详情
      • 登录可信成绩单系统
      • 获取可信成绩单
    • 考试安排
      • 查询考试安排
      • 查询考试安排主页
      • 获取访问权限
    • 乐学
      • 获取日历订阅链接
  • 订阅模块
    • 订阅
    • 获取订阅列表
  1. 话廊模块

获取帖子列表

开发中
GET
/posters

根据mode选择不同的模式

  • recommend:推荐模式,此时忽略search、order和uid,返回public=true,anonymous任意的帖子。

  • search:搜索模式,此时需要考虑search、order和uid。当uid<0返回public=true,anonymous任意的帖子;当uid=0时,全部返回;当uid>0时,仅返回public=true且anonymous=false的帖子。

  • follow:关注模式,此时忽略search、order和uid,返回public=true,anonymous=false,按时间倒序的帖子。

  • hot:热榜模式,此时忽略search、order和uid,返回public=true,anonymous任意的帖子。

  • hide_bot: 是否隐藏机器人,仅在search模式有效

请求参数

Query 参数
mode
string 
可选
模式 recommend | search | follow | hot 默认为recommend
示例值:
search
page
integer 
可选
页码 从0开始 默认为0
search
string 
搜索参数 默认为空
可选
order
integer 
可选
排序方式 comment | like | new 默认为new
uid
integer 
可选
特定用户 -1为不筛选 0时为自己返回非public的 默认为-1
示例值:
-1
hide_bot
integer 
可选
隐藏机器人 0为不隐藏 其他隐藏 默认为0
示例值:
0
Header 参数
fake-cookie
string 
可选
示例值:
{{fake_cookie}}

示例代码

Shell
JavaScript
Java
Swift
Go
PHP
Python
HTTP
C
C#
Objective-C
Ruby
OCaml
Dart
R
请求示例请求示例
Shell
JavaScript
Java
Swift
curl --location --request GET 'https://bit101.flwfdd.xyz/posters?mode=search&page=&search=&order=&uid=-1&hide_bot=0' \
--header 'fake-cookie: {{fake_cookie}}'

返回响应

🟢200成功
application/json
Body
array of:
id
integer 
必需
title
string 
标题
必需
text
string 
内容
必需
images
array[object (图片) {3}] 
图片
必需
图片链接列表
>= 0 items<= 24 items
mid
string 
图片唯一编码
必需
url
string 
原图链接
必需
low_url
string 
低分辨率图片链接
必需
like_num
integer 
点赞数量
必需
comment_num
integer 
评论数量
必需
create_time
string 
发布时间
必需
edit_time
string 
编辑时间
必需
update_time
string 
更新时间
必需
有新点赞评论等也算更新
user
object (用户) 
发布用户
必需
id
integer 
必需
create_time
string 
注册时间
必需
nickname
string 
昵称
必需
avatar
object (图片) 
头像链接
必需
motto
string 
格言/简介
必需
identity
object 
身份
必需
anonymous
boolean 
匿名
必需
发送者是否匿名
tags
array[string]
标签
必需
claim
object (声明) 
声明
必需
如政治相关等
id
integer 
必需
text
string 
声明内容
必需
public
boolean 
公开
必需
公开或仅自己可见
示例
[
    {
        "id": 0,
        "title": "string",
        "text": "string",
        "images": [
            {
                "mid": "string",
                "url": "string",
                "low_url": "string"
            }
        ],
        "like_num": 0,
        "comment_num": 0,
        "create_time": "string",
        "edit_time": "string",
        "update_time": "string",
        "user": {
            "id": 0,
            "create_time": "string",
            "nickname": "string",
            "avatar": {
                "mid": "string",
                "url": "string",
                "low_url": "string"
            },
            "motto": "string",
            "identity": {
                "id": 0,
                "color": "string",
                "text": "string"
            }
        },
        "anonymous": true,
        "tags": [
            "string"
        ],
        "claim": {
            "id": 0,
            "text": "string"
        },
        "public": true
    }
]
🟠404记录不存在
🟠400参数不正确
🔴500服务器错误
🟠401身份验证失败
上一页
发送系统消息
下一页
获取帖子
Built with